jakob trollback rethinks the music video

I'm working a lot with motion and animation, and also I'm an old DJ and a musician. So, music videos are something that I always found interesting, but they always seem to be so reactive. So I was thinking, can you remove us as creators and try to make the music be the voice and have the animation following it? So with two designers, Tolga and Christina, at my office, we took a track—many of you probably know it. It's about 25 years old, and it's David Byrne and Brian Eno—and we did this little animation. And I think that it's maybe interesting, also, that it deals with two problematic issues, which are rising waters and religion.
